Abstract

PURPOSE: A BSM(Base Station Manager) failure message analyzing method is provided to extract a failure message outputted from a BSM in an operator's desired format and quickly and easily analyze it. CONSTITUTION: A failure occurs due to some reason while a mobile communication system is being operated(S202). A BSM outputs a failure message(source data) by hexadecimal(S204). Process(analysis) data in an operator's desired format is extracted from the source data by inputting a command language in a shell script sentence(S206). Several process data are extracted from the source data and common points and relationship among the several extracted process data are searched to find out a cause of a failure(S208). A suitable measure is taken according to the cause of the failure to thereby remove the cause of the failure(S210).

일반적인 이동통신 시스템의 중앙제어 및 교환국은 하나의 기지국관리부(BSM: Base Station Manager)와 다수의 기지국제어부(BSC: Base Station Controller) 및 기지국(BTS: Base Station)이 연결되고, 상기 하나의 기지국관리부(BSM)에는 다수개(일실시예로, 12개)의 지지국제어부(BSC)가 연결되며, 하나의 기지국제어부(BSC)에는 다수개(일실시예로, 12개 또는 16개)의 기지국(BTS)이연결된다.A central control and switching center of a general mobile communication system is connected to a base station manager (BSM), a plurality of base station controllers (BSC) and a base station (BTS), and the base station manager A plurality of BSCs are connected to the BSM, and a plurality of base stations (12 or 16 base stations) are connected to one base station controller BSC. (BTS) is connected.

이하 이동통신 시스템에 대하여 첨부된 도면을 참고로 설명한다.Hereinafter, a mobile communication system will be described with reference to the accompanying drawings.

도 1은 일반적인 이동통신 시스템의 기능 블록도이다.1 is a functional block diagram of a general mobile communication system.

도시된 바와 같이, 중앙제어 및 교환국(10), 기지국관리부(20), 기지국제어부(30), 기지국(40)으로 구성된다.As shown, the central control and switching center 10, the base station manager 20, the base station controller 30, the base station 40 is composed of.

상기 중앙제어 및 교환국(10)은 시스템 전체를 제어 및 감시하고 발신자와 착신자의 통신 경로를 연결한다.The central control and switching center 10 controls and monitors the entire system and connects the communication path of the caller and the called party.

상기 기지국관리부(20)는 중앙제어 및 교환국(10)과 연결되어 제어를 받으며 양방향으로 데이터를 전송하고 워크 스테이션(Work Station)급 컴퓨터로 이루어지며, 기지국 전체를 제어 및 관장하는 프로그램이 저장되어 있는 동시에 상기 프로그램 및 기지국 운용 파라미터(Parameter)를 변경한다.The base station manager 20 is connected to the central control and switching center 10 under control and transmits data in both directions, and is made of a work station class computer, and stores a program for controlling and managing the entire base station. At the same time, the program and base station operating parameters are changed.

기지국제어부(30)는 상기 기지국관리부(20)에 다수가 연결되며, 기지국관리부(20)로부터 프로그램을 다운 로딩(Down Loading)하여 받아 운용된다.A plurality of base station controllers 30 are connected to the base station manager 20, and are operated by downloading a program from the base station manager 20.

기지국(40)은 상기 기지국제어부(30)에 다수가 연결되며 기지국제어부(30)로부터 프로그램을 다운 로딩 받고, 상기 기지국관리부(20)로부터 필요한 운용 파라미터를 다운 로딩하여 받는다.The base station 40 is connected to the base station control unit 30, a plurality of download the program from the base station control unit 30, downloads and receives the required operating parameters from the base station management unit 20.

구체적으로 상기 기지국제어부(30)는 기지국제어부 전체를 제어 및 감시함과 동시에 통신 경로(Path) 연결 과정인 호(Call)를 처리하며, 음성신호를 디지털 신호로 변환한다(Vocoding).Specifically, the base station controller 30 controls and monitors the entire base station controller, processes a call, which is a communication path connection process, and converts a voice signal into a digital signal (Vocoding).

상기 기지국(40)은, 기지국 전체를 제어하고 감시하고, 기지국에서 운용되는클럭 신호와 시간 및 주파수를 제어하고 관리한다.The base station 40 controls and monitors the entire base station, and controls and manages a clock signal, a time and a frequency operated by the base station.

또한 기지국에서 송수신되는 디지털 채널을 제어하고 감시하며, 기지국에 할당된 각 채널별 고주파 발생부를 제어하고 관리한다.In addition, it controls and monitors digital channels transmitted and received from the base station, and controls and manages a high frequency generator for each channel assigned to the base station.

이하 본 발명의 실시예에 대하여 첨부된 도면을 참고로 그 구성 및 작용을 설명하기로 한다.Hereinafter, the configuration and operation of the present invention will be described with reference to the accompanying drawings.

도 2는 도 2는 본 발명에 따른 장애 메시지 분석방법의 순서도이다.2 is a flowchart of a failure message analysis method according to the present invention.

이동통신 시스템 운용중에 어떤 원인에 의해 장애가 발생한다(S202).The failure occurs due to some cause during the operation of the mobile communication system (S202).

CDMA2000 1X BSM에서는 아래와 같은 F3000 형식의 장애 메시지(원시 데이터)를 16진수로 출력한다(S204).The CDMA2000 1X BSM outputs a failure message (raw data) of F3000 format as shown below in hexadecimal (S204).

[sybsm119] 2002-05-23 18:00:02 THU[sybsm119] 2002-05-23 18:00:02 THU

F3000 CALL FAULTF3000 CALL FAULT

MS_ID : 0112377884MS_ID: 0112377884

CAUSE : 231CAUSE: 231

CALL STATE: 1, CALL SUB STATE : 4CALL STATE: 1, CALL SUB STATE: 4

LOCATION : NID_ 129/SID_2236/BSC_00/BTS_03/SECT_1/FAIDX_04LOCATION: NID_ 129 / SID_2236 / BSC_00 / BTS_03 / SECT_1 / FAIDX_04

CALL CLASS: 0CALL CLASS: 0

REASON : F3000_ABN_SCCP_RE_IN_SETUP[RFC_17]_[DISC_80]REASON: F3000_ABN_SCCP_RE_IN_SETUP [RFC_17] _ [DISC_80]

USRDATAUSRDATA

65faf3ae000300490409ff240d61ff011237788400000000000000006065faf3ae000300490409ff240d61ff0112377884000000000000000060

001900113b39000100013303310003023d5600f000000003020039365f001900113b39000100013303310003023d5600f000000003020039365f

00000000000000000000000000000000000000000000ffffffffffffff00000000000000000000000000000000000000000000ffffffffffffff

0000000000000000000000000000ffffffff00000000000000000000000000000000000000000000000000ffffffff0000000000000000000000

0000000000000000000000000000000000000000000000000000000000000000000000000000

COMPLETEDCOMPLETED

상기 원시 데이터에서 아래의 실시예와 같은 순서에 의해 셀(SHELL) 스크립트문으로 명령어를 입력하여 운용자가 원하는 형태로 가공(분석) 데이터를 추출한다(S206).In the raw data, a command is input to a shell script statement in the same order as in the following embodiment to extract processed (analyzed) data in a form desired by an operator (S206).

1. sgrep.awk를 ∼/tool 디렉토리 아래에 복사한다.1. Copy sgrep.awk under the ~ / tool directory.

2. 홈디렉토리에서 vi .cshrc를 열어 다음과 같이 입력한다.2. Open vi .cshrc in your home directory and type:

alias samdol 'awk -f/home1/cdmaone/tool/sgrep.awk'alias samdol 'awk -f / home1 / cdmaone / tool / sgrep.awk'

3. f3000 디렉토리로 이동하여 다음과 같이 사용한다.Go to the f3000 directory and use:

1) tail -f 15.F3000HD (시간대별 f3000 화일) │mgrep BSC_00/BTS_00(원하는 기지국 주소 │SHELL SCRIPT1) tail -f 15.F3000HD (f3000 file by time zone) │mgrep BSC_00 / BTS_00 (desired base station address│SHELL SCRIPT

2) mgrep BSC_00/BTS_00(원하는 기지국 주소) -i 15.F3000HD(시간대별 f3000 파일) │ SHELL SCRIPT >(저장화일이름)2) mgrep BSC_00 / BTS_00 (desired base station address) -i 15.F3000HD (time f3000 file) │ SHELL SCRIPT> (file name)

아래는 운용자가 원하는 형태로 추출된 한 예이다.The following is an example extracted in the form desired by the operator.

[18:00:02]BSC_00/03/S1/F04..ABN_SCCP_RE_IN_SETUP[RFC_17]_[DISC_80] *-* ATPff_SO03_TC09_CN011237788400000_B0_CP0_CE00[18:00:02] BSC_00 / 03 / S1 / F04..ABN_SCCP_RE_IN_SETUP [RFC_17] _ [DISC_80] *-* ATPff_SO03_TC09_CN011237788400000_B0_CP0_CE00

상기 추출된 예는 앞에서부터 순서대로 기지국(BSC_00/03/), 섹터(S1), 주파수할당(F04), F3000 원인(ABN_SCCP_RE_IN_SETUP[RFC_17]_[DISC_80]), BSC 프로세서(ATPff) 번호, 서비스 옵션(SO03), BSC 보코더 번호(TC09), 발신자 번호(CN011237788400000), 기지국 중계선 번호(B0), 기지국 메인 보코더 번호(CP0), 기지국 서브 보코더 번호(CE00)를 나타낸다.The extracted example is a base station (BSC_00 / 03 /), sector (S1), frequency allocation (F04), F3000 cause (ABN_SCCP_RE_IN_SETUP [RFC_17] _ [DISC_80]), BSC processor (ATPff) number, service option (SO03), BSC vocoder number (TC09), caller number (CN011237788400000), base station relay line number (B0), base station main vocoder number (CP0), and base station sub vocoder number (CE00).

상기 분석(가공) 데이터의 구성을 보면, 각 정보가 제목을 나타내는 영문과 실 데이터를 나타내는 숫자의 조합 형태로 구성되고, 상기와 같은 구성된 각 정보가 운용자가 원하는 순서대로 나열되어, 상세한 정보를 눈으로 식별하여 금방 알아볼 수 있는 것이다.Looking at the configuration of the analysis (processing) data, each information is composed of a combination of the English letters representing the title and the number representing the actual data, each of the above configured information is arranged in the order desired by the operator, the detailed information I can identify it quickly.

다음 상기와 같은 단계의 반복으로 원시 데이터에서 가공 데이터를 여러 개 추출하고 추출된 여러 분석(가공) 데이터에서 공통점과 연관성을 찾아 장애를 유발하는 원인을 알아낸다(S208).Next, a plurality of processing data is extracted from the raw data by repetition of the above steps, and the cause of the failure is found by finding commonalities and associations in the extracted various analysis (processing) data (S208).

상기 장애 원인에 따라 적절한 조치를 취하여 장애 원인을 제거한다(S210).Appropriate measures are taken according to the cause of the failure to remove the cause of the failure (S210).
